I installed this unit on my 2008 RXV. I had a little trouble getting the float length just right, to insure the dash gauge shows fuel level accurately. But after I got it adjusted correctly it's been working great for almost 2 years. Sure is nice not having to lift the seat to see how much fuel is left. Last edited by bsain; 06-15-2012 at 09:43 AM..
